With over 15 years of dedicated experience in Obstetrics and Gynecology care, Dr. Davis brings a wealth of clinical knowledge and compassionate care to his patients and their families. He earned his medical degree from Ohio University Heritage College Of Osteopathic Medicine and completed an internship and residency in Obstetrics and Gynecology at Akron General Medical Center, followed by fellowship training at Albert Einstein College Of Medicine, further specializing his expertise. Prior to joining Shady Grove Fertility, Dr. Davis served as Medical Director at Cayman Fertility Centre and held numerous academic positions, contributing to peer-reviewed journals and research, particularly in endometriosis, genetics, and diminished ovarian reserve. He is currently on the board of the UK-based Endometriosis Foundation. Dr. Davis believes in empowering patients to make informed decisions about their care, leading to the best possible outcomes. - What is Polycystic Ovarian Syndrome (PCOS)?
- Polycystic Ovarian Syndrome (PCOS) is a common hormonal condition that can cause irregular periods, acne, and excess hair growth, and may impact fertility. Dr. Joseph Davis can help with symptom management and long-term health planning.
- What are my options for birth control?
- Many safe and effective birth control options exist, including hormonal methods like pills and IUDs, and non-hormonal options. Dr. Davis will discuss your lifestyle, health history, and preferences to determine the best fit for you.
- What are uterine fibroids and should I be concerned?
- Uterine fibroids are very common, non-cancerous growths in the uterus. They are often asymptomatic, but can sometimes cause heavy bleeding or pain. Dr. Davis can help monitor them and discuss treatment options if they become problematic.
- At what age should I start getting mammograms, and how often?
- Recommendations for mammograms generally start at age 40, but can vary based on family history and personal risk factors. Dr. Davis will assess your individual risk to recommend the most appropriate screening schedule to ensure early detection of breast cancer.
